MOT History from tests of petrol TOYOTA MASTERs year 1987

Review the list of common TOYOTA MASTER failures below or to perform a specific mot history check on your TOYOTA then use our popular KnowYourCar service

mot history
Pass percent:26.32%
(The average a petrol TOYOTA MASTER year 1987 passes without issue)
Based on:19 MOT Tests
Most common failuresNo# failures
Nearside Front position lamp|s| not working |1.1.A.3b|4
Registration plate lamp issues4
Rear fog lamp tell tale not working |1.3.1b|2
Offside Front position lamp|s| not working |1.1.A.3b|2
Headlamp aim out of alignment2
Parking brake: efficiency below requirements |3.7.B.7|2
Nearside Stop lamp not working |1.2.1b|2
Offside Rear fog lamp not working |1.3.2b|2
Registration plate issues2
Offside Rear fog lamp missing |1.3.2a|2
Brake hose excessively deteriorated2

We get to these numbers by trawling through over 1 billion MOT test results since 2004 and crunched the numbers. We remove anything to do with Tyres, as they are model independent and group together common non-model specific issues. We are trying to get to a picture of what models have what issues.

Please note: We take the data from the DVSA. This data is raw and can contain typos and spelling mistakes that garages may have entered while recording a MOT result. Specifically miss-match on names of models and makes. We are constantly cleaning the data so bear with the odd issue.
